Output 51836bf8b361976d4d4d2f986d39ce5330200f924cd040a1eb59bb5a17c80eac:0

value
86929172
script pubkey
OP_0 OP_PUSHBYTES_20 3dff0a835afcad422c946f74a780d09086e1ed6e
address
bc1q8hls4q66ljk5yty5da620qxsjzrwrmtw2ann69
transaction
51836bf8b361976d4d4d2f986d39ce5330200f924cd040a1eb59bb5a17c80eac
spent
true